  1. About 70 or 80 years ago there were seven pipers who used to go from place to place playing. Their names were Joyce. Sometimes they used to stay around here. Every Sunday they used to have a dance on Portrun shore. The people used to pay them every round a penny or twopence. The dance was from two o'clock till 8 o'clock.
